Microchip Technology's PIC16F18445-I/P Microcontroller
The PIC16F18445-I/P is a versatile and powerful 8-bit microcontroller from Microchip Technology, designed to cater to a wide range of applications, from consumer electronics to industrial control systems. This microcontroller is part of the enhanced mid-range PIC16F family, known for its excellent performance-to-cost ratio, and is housed in a 14-pin PDIP (Plastic Dual In-line Package), making it suitable for breadboard prototyping and easy soldering on printed circuit boards.
At the heart of the PIC16F18445-I/P lies a high-performance RISC CPU with a rich set of features. It boasts a clock speed of up to 32 MHz and incorporates 14 KB of flash memory for program storage, along with 1 KB of SRAM and 256 bytes of EEPROM for data storage. This combination of memory options provides ample space for complex programs and data retention across power cycles.
The device is equipped with an extensive range of peripherals that enhance its functionality. It includes up to 12 channels of 10-bit Analog-to-Digital Converters (ADC), allowing for precise analog signal measurement. The microcontroller also features two PWM modules, a pair of comparators, and a Complementary Waveform Generator (CWG) that simplify motor control and other waveform generation tasks. For communication purposes, the PIC16F18445-I/P supports I2C, SPI, and EUSART interfaces, enabling it to connect with other microcontrollers, sensors, and peripheral devices.
One of the standout features of this MCU is its Intelligent Analog integration, which includes the Core Independent Peripherals (CIPs) like the Zero Cross Detect (ZCD) module, enhancing the efficiency of power control applications. The CIPs enable the microcontroller to perform tasks autonomously, reducing the workload on the CPU and allowing for lower power consumption and faster system response.
Furthermore, the PIC16F18445-I/P supports Microchip's MPLAB X Integrated Development Environment (IDE) and MPLAB Code Configurator for streamlined development. It also supports low-power operation modes, making it an excellent choice for battery-operated devices.
